Children's Prayers
Dear God,
>Please put another holiday between Christmas and Easter. There is nothing
>good in there now.
Amanda
>
>Dear God,
>Thank you for the baby brother but what I asked for was a puppy. I never
>asked for anything before. You can look it up.
>Joyce
>
>Dear Mr. God,
>I wish you would not make it so easy for people to come apart. I had to have
>3 stitches and a shot.
>Janet
>
>God,
>I read the Bible. What does beget mean? Nobody will tell me.
>Love, Alison
>
>Dear God,
>How did you know you were God? Who told you?
>Charlene
>
>Dear God,
>Is it true my father won't get in Heaven if he uses his golf words in the
>house?
>Anita
>
>Dear God,
>I bet it's very hard for you to love all of everybody in the whole world.
>There are only 4 people in our family and I can never do it.
>Nancy
>
>Dear God,
>I like the story about Noah the best of all of them. You really made up some
>good ones. I like walking on water, too.
>Glenn
>
>Dear God,
>My Grandpa says you were around when he was a little boy. How far back do you
>go?
>Love, Dennis
>
>Dear God,
>Do you draw the lines around the countries? If you don't who does?
>Nathan
>
>Dear God,
>Did you mean for giraffes to look like that or was it an accident?
>Norma
>
>Dear God,
>In Bible times, did they really talk that fancy?
>Jennifer
>
>Dear God,
>How come you did all those miracles in the old days and don't do any now?
>Billy
>
>Dear God,
>Please send Dennis Clark to a different summer camp this year.
>Peter
>
>Dear God,
>Maybe Cain and Abel would not kill each other so much if they each had their
>own rooms. It works out OK with me and my brother.
>Larry
>
>Dear God,
>I keep waiting for spring, but it never did come yet. What's up? Don't
>forget.
>Mark
>
>Dear God,
>My brother told me about how you are born but it just doesn't sound right.
>What do you say?
>Marsha
>
>Dear God,
>Is Reverend Coe a friend of yours or do you just know him through the business?
>Donny
>
>Dear God,
>I do not think anybody could be a better God than you. Well, I just want you
>to know that. I am not just saying that because you are already God.
>Charles
>
>Dear God,
>It is great the way you always get the stars in the right place. Why don't
>you do that with the moon?
>Jeff
>
>Dear God,
>I am doing the best I can. Really!!!!
>Frank
>
and saving the best for last....
>
>Dear God,
>I didn't think orange went with purple until I saw the sunset you made on
>Tuesday night. That was really cool.
>Thomas
